Ana María Martínez (born 1971) is a Puerto Rican soprano . Early life. Martínez was born in San Juan, Puerto Rico; she is the daughter of Puerto Rican opera singer Evangelína Colón [1] [2] and Cuban psychoanalyst Ángel Martínez. Martínez' grandparents originated in Spain and France, and migrated to the Caribbean islands.

Biography. Born in San Juan (Porto Rico), Ana Maria Martínez graduated from the Juilliard School. In 1993, she was finalist at the auditions of the New York Metropolitan Opera. She won many awards, including the first prize at the Eleanor McCollum Awards in 1994, the Pepita Embil Award at the Plácido Domingo’s Operalia in 1995, a Grammy ...

Martínez Ana María - Bayerische Staatsoper. Ana María Martínez erhielt ihre Ausbildung an der Juilliard School in New York und am Houston Grand Opera Studio. Sie gastierte an zahlreichen Opernhäusern, u. a in Berlin, Hamburg, Dresden, Wien, Amsterdam, London, Paris, San Francisco und New York.
